According to media reports, at the October 2024 India International Renewable Energy Exhibition (REI India), Indian solar module manufacturing giant Waaree Energies launched a new N-type heterojunction (HJT) bifacial glass PV module designed for large-scale solar projects.

Key Specifications:

· Power output: 730W

· Conversion efficiency: 23.5%

· Bifaciality rate: >85%

· Annual degradation rate: 0.3%

Waaree commits to a 12-year product warranty and a 30-year performance warranty for this module.

Technical Highlights:

The N-type HJT bifacial glass PV module represents a cutting-edge solar technology. Using N-type silicon as the base material, it delivers superior performance in photovoltaic conversion efficiency, temperature coefficient, and low-light response. The heterojunction structure—composed of two distinct semiconductor materials—reduces electron-hole recombination, enhancing overall efficiency.

Advantages of Bifacial Glass Packaging​​:

1. Durability: Weather resistance and corrosion protection ensure long-term protection of internal cells and circuits.

2. Mechanical Strength: Dual-glass design improves structural stability, enabling better resistance to external impacts and vibrations.

3. Bifacial Power Generation: High bifaciality allows the rear side to generate power from reflected light, boosting total energy output. This innovation positions Waaree Energies as a leader in advancing high-efficiency solar solutions for global markets.
